What companies run services between Grand Central Terminal, NY, USA and Notre-Dame Church, QC, Canada?
Trailways operates a bus from New York to Montreal 3 times a day. Tickets cost $75–330 and the journey takes 8h 20m. Greyhound USA also services this route 4 times a day.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a train from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station to Montreal Central Station once daily. Tickets cost $100–190 and the journey takes 13h 1m.
